SLED Charges Former Hanahan Police Department Sergeant with Misconduct in Office
BERKELEY COUNTY, SOUTH CAROLINA, JUL 23 – Hernandez admitted to misusing police tools for personal projects and failing to submit evidence properly, with stolen items recovered from his home by authorities.

SLED charges former Hanahan Police Department sergeant with misconduct in office
HANAHAN, S.C. (WCBD) – A former Hanahan police sergeant has been charged with misconduct in office. The South Carolina Law Enforcement Division announced Wednesday charges against 31-year-old Carlos Juan Fernando Reyna Hernandez.
